A Russian missile strike on the Odessa region destroyed grain silos at the port of Yuzhny, according to Ukraine’s Ministry of Infrastructure, this is reported by the railway transport news portal Railway Supply.

Russia struck one of the Delta Wilmar terminals

“Two terminals specializing in the handling of agricultural products in the port of Yuzhny were attacked.

One of the terminals belongs to the globally renowned Singaporean company Delta Wilmar, which has been operating in Ukraine since 2004 and also owns several agricultural processing plants.

This represents over $300 million in investments and around 1,000 jobs,” the statement said.

It is noted that this is the 39th Russian attack on port infrastructure objects in the Odessa region – 215 objects have been damaged or partially destroyed, along with 153 vehicles, 8 civilian vessels, and 26 civilians injured.
